Career path

```html
career roles key responsibilities
port compliance officer ensure adherence to regulations, conduct audits, and manage compliance documentation
maritime safety inspector inspect vessels and port facilities, enforce safety standards, and report violations
environmental compliance specialist monitor environmental regulations, assess risks, and implement sustainable practices
customs and border protection officer oversee cargo inspections, enforce trade laws, and prevent illegal activities
port operations manager coordinate port activities, ensure regulatory compliance, and optimize operations
shipping compliance analyst analyze shipping regulations, ensure compliance, and provide training to staff
risk and compliance consultant assess compliance risks, develop mitigation strategies, and advise stakeholders
